TAFE = Technical and Further Education.

Basically it's like a trade college, where you go to learn to be a mechanic and stuff like that. Though they have computing courses too. It's more hands on than a university course, and there aren't any arts subjects like there are at university.

In September, a 20 degree day is cool, the average temp would be around 23-27 degrees. Nice and warm
